Position Overview

Reporting to the Sales Team Lead, this person will play a key role in expanding ClearEstate’s presence in the Québec market. The selected candidate will own the sales process and work in close partnership with our legal experts at Cain Lamarre (notaries and tax specialists) during joint consultations with families. Cain Lamarre provides all technical expertise, allowing the Account Executive to focus entirely on client relationships, needs assessment, and guiding families toward the appropriate estate solutions.

This role blends direct-to-family sales with partnership development. Working closely with our Partnerships team, you’ll help build strong relationships with wealth advisors to generate a steady stream of qualified referrals.

What you’ll do

  • You’ll play a meaningful role in helping families during a pivotal time, while contributing to the growth of ClearEstate.
  • Expertly lead discovery and consultation calls with empathy and clarity, identifying client needs and recommending appropriate estate solutions.
  • Manage the full sales cycle in both direct-to-consumer and referred-lead contexts, from first contact to closing.
  • Build tailored, complex service proposals independently.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ally to improve our service offering and refine messaging based on client feedback.
  • Demonstrate sound knowledge of estate planning and settlement, adapting to jurisdictional nuances across Canada and the US.
  • Identify opportunities to optimize the sales process through feedback, data, and collaboration.
  • Maintain up-to-date CRM records and manage pipeline efficiently.
  • Maintain consultation availabilities Monday-Thursday 12pm to 8pm EST and Friday 9am to 5pm EST.

ClearEstate emerged from a personal and challenging experience. Co-founder Alexandre Gauthier, after the passing of his mother, found himself navigating the labyrinthine and often emotionally taxing process of estate settlement. This arduous 18-month undertaking, filled with confusing paperwork and legal complexities, sparked the realization that there had to be a better, more humane way. Drawing from his background in e-commerce and marketing, Gauthier envisioned a user-friendly platform designed to simplify this journey for the average person. In November 2020, this vision materialized as ClearEstate, co-founded with Davide Pisanu, who brought a wealth of experience from law and management, including roles at McKinsey & Company and Cirque du Soleil. Pascal Brisset also joined as a co-founder and CTO.

The mission was clear: to demystify the responsibilities of estate executors and guide them through the often opaque probate process with efficiency and empathy. ClearEstate recognized that traditional estate settlement could consume hundreds of hours and stretch over a year, a period during which executors, often grieving, were ill-equipped for the complexities involved. The company set out to build a digital-first, all-in-one solution. Early on, they realized that a purely SaaS (Software as a Service) model wasn't sufficient for users grappling with grief; a human touch was essential. This led to a hybrid approach, combining their intuitive online platform with personalized support from a team of estate professionals. This blend of technology and compassionate guidance aims to save families significant time and money, preserving the value of estates and easing the burden on loved ones during difficult times. ClearEstate's journey has been one of rapid growth and adaptation, driven by the goal of making estate planning and settlement accessible, affordable, and stress-free for everyone.
